Argentina's President-Elect Javier Milei Enjoys High Approval Ratings Despite Controversial Policies

Milei's victory sends a reassuring message to anti-democratic populist forces worldwide, but he faces significant challenges upon taking office.

  • President-elect Javier Milei is enjoying a peak honeymoon phase in Argentina, with a 55 percent approval rating and positive economic expectations from the public.
  • Milei has been meeting with high-level political leaders and officials, including former US president Bill Clinton and members of the International Monetary Fund.
  • Despite his popularity, several of Milei's main electoral promises, such as interrupting diplomatic relations with Brazil and China and dollarizing the economy, are not supported by the majority of respondents in a recent poll.
  • Milei's administration is expected to face a tough situation upon taking office, with runaway inflation, a scuttled Central Bank, and a fragmented political field.
  • Milei's victory is sending a reassuring message to anti-democratic populist forces worldwide, with figures like former U.S. President Donald Trump celebrating his win.
